Our shared religious lifeOur Worship Service at North Shore Unitarian Universalists is the heart of our shared religious life. It is a time to share joys and concerns, to listen to inspiring music, to remind us of who we are and of our responsibilities to others, and to experience life from the depths of our souls. Contemporary and casualOur services are contemporary. Dress is casual. Our sanctuary is a restful open space, which is surrounded by large windows that allow us to appreciate the wonders of nature.
Order of serviceOur order of service includes inspirational music, readings, and a sermon. Our sermons are delivered by ministers and by lay leaders. Also we have special services throughout the year. We collect an offering to support our church mission and charitable work in our community. All visitors, friends, and members are welcome to donate at the offering, but do not need to do so.
Following the serviceEveryone is invited to stay for coffee, cookies, and conversation following the service. On special occasions a discussion group, an adult education class, or full church gathering follows the service. Often, we serve a full luncheon buffet in our outdoor garden; everyone who attends the service including all visitors are welcome to join us. |
